According to Reuters, the Dow Jones Industrial Average opened up 393.7 points, or 0.85%, at 46978.17. The S&P 500 index opened sharply higher, gaining 137.5 points, or 2.08%, at 6754.36. The Nasdaq Composite index surged 803.4 points, or 3.65%, at 22821.21. According to AFP, the Dow Jones once rose 2.8% in early trading after the opening. Major Wall Street indices were up about 3% in early trading. The market expects oil and other key products to resume transportation through the Strait of Hormuz, leading to a sharp drop in crude oil prices, a strengthening of airline stocks, and a decline in oil company stock prices.
